Coleman to Thunder Bay

Updated: 31 May 2026

The journey from Coleman to Thunder Bay is a massive undertaking of over 2,200 kilometers. Driving takes approximately 25 hours, crossing the Canadian Prairies and Northern Ontario. Most travelers prefer to drive to Calgary and take a flight to Thunder Bay International Airport. This is a major cross-country trip that requires significant planning.

Total Distance: 2,200 km driving distance, 1,700 km straight-line air distance.
Fastest Way
Flying from Calgary is the fastest, taking about 6 hours total.
Cheapest Way
Flying is often cheaper than the fuel and accommodation costs of a 3-day drive.

Things to Do in Thunder Bay
1
Sleeping Giant Provincial Park
A beautiful park with hiking trails and great views of Lake Superior.
2
Kakabeka Falls
A stunning waterfall located just outside the city.
3
Fort William Historical Park
A historic site offering tours and demonstrations.
4
Marina Park
A beautiful park along the shore of Lake Superior.
